OPPO released 240W super flash charging technology, which can fully charge the phone in 9 minutes. OPPO officially released the longevity version 150W super flash charge, 240W super flash charge, and the new 5G CPE product OPPO 5G CPE T2 at MWC 2022.


Longevity Version 150W Super Flash Charge

Continuing the leading technical architecture of OPPO 125W super flash charging, the longevity version 150W super flash charging further optimizes the software design, upgrades the PCB battery protection board, and supports up to 20V/7.5A output. In order to ensure the safety of high-power charging, the longevity version 150W super flash charger is also equipped with 13 temperature sensors to monitor the charging status in real-time, and a fuse-type overvoltage protection circuit is used to ensure the safety of full-link charging; the cable passes through a 128-bit high Strong hardware encryption to eliminate security risks.

▲ The longevity version of the 150W super flash charge follows the OPPO charge pump direct charging technology, which can charge a mobile phone with an equivalent 4500mAh battery capacity from 1% to 50% in 5 minutes, and to 100% in the fastest 15 minutes.


In addition, the longevity version of the 150W super flash charger is smaller than conventional products of the same power, only 58mm x 57mm x 30mm and weighs 172g. While taking into account high efficiency and portability, the power density is significantly improved.

▲ The power density of the 150W super flash charge of the longevity version is 1.51W/cm

In order to improve the user's charging experience more comprehensively, the longevity version 150W super flash charger is equipped with OPPO's self-developed battery health engine. Through OPPO's customized battery management chip, smart battery health algorithm, and bionic repair electrolyte technology, two core technologies, From the algorithm and battery chemical system to protect the safety of charging and discharging, and intelligently improve the battery life.

As a system-level algorithm independently developed by OPPO's flash charging laboratory for three years, OPPO said that the smart battery health algorithm can instantly grasp and track the negative electrode potential of the mobile phone battery and control it within a reasonable range, and dynamically regulate charging through intelligent The current keeps it maximized while minimizing the presence of dead lithium, extending battery life.

In addition, OPPO also uses bionic repair electrolyte technology to optimize the interior of the battery. By improving the electrolyte formula, this technology continuously repairs the electrodes during the battery charge and discharge cycle forms a more stable and durable solid electrolyte dielectric (SEI) and keeps it in a perfect state in real-time, reducing the wear and tear of the positive and negative electrodes of the battery. This enhances battery life and extends battery life.

▲ Under the premise of ensuring the high-speed charging of super flash charging with the same power, the mobile phone equipped with the battery health engine can still have 80% capacity after being fully charged and put back into the circle 1600 times, far exceeding the current industry average of 800 times of charge and discharge. Recycle the battery health of more than 80% to maximize battery life and improve user experience.


In the future, the battery health engine will be used as a standard configuration for fast charging in OPPO and OnePlus flagship series mobile phones. The long-life version of the 150W super flash charge equipped with the battery health engine will also be officially launched on OnePlus phones in the second quarter of this year. release.

240W Super Flash Charge

OPPO conducted more research on the basis of the flash charging architecture and launched a 240W super flash charging, which can support up to 24V/10A charging and can charge a mobile phone with an equivalent 4500mAh battery up to 100% in about 9 minutes.

In terms of temperature control and heat dissipation, the 240W super flash charge ensures temperature control and safety throughout the entire charging process of chargers, cables, and batteries, and greatly reduces heat generation.

As of December 2021, OPPO has applied for more than 3,390 global patents in the field of fast charging and has authorized about 1,786 patents. It has opened up flash charging patent licenses to more than 50 companies and has provided more than 30 models equipped with VOOC and SUPERVOOC flash charging technologies.
